Anyone have/had a Lotus Esprit?

I've always been intrigued by the Esprit. I thought the 4-banger turbo was so cool because it was unique in the auto world.

Supercar speed
Supercar looks
Supercar price

...and 4 cylinders! Just completely unconventional and wacky. Plus it wasn't from Italy like most other high-dollar exotics. So cool.

Eventually they kind of messed it up, IMO. They dropped in a big V8, and kept adding to the bodywork to (presumably) make it more ferocious looking - ruining the simple good looks of the earlier versions.

Anyway, anyone have one? Anyone drive one? If so, what do you think of it? Are they especially repair-prone? What's the upkeep like?
